Welcome back to Witching Hour – the show where two mums and sort of cousins figure out how to make work, work. Today on the show:
- The great school holiday juggle: Who’s actually getting a break? (spoiler alert - it’s not mums)
Australia’s unpaid labour is worth $688 billion and women are doing most of it.
—
In this episode we cover: school holidays and the mental load, invisible labour and emotional burnout, working motherhood, overstimulation, default parent culture, the cost of school holiday activities, juggling work and care, mum guilt and overwhelm, why women absorb the planning and prep, and how families can actually survive the holiday juggle without losing their minds.
